
安装MySQL数据库8.0.19的步骤主要包括:下载、安装、配置、启动服务、设置root用户密码、测试连接。其中,下载和安装是最基础的步骤,而配置涉及到数据库的基本设置,是安装过程中最关键的一步,因为正确的配置可以确保数据库运行的稳定性和安全性。
一、下载MySQL 8.0.19
1. 官方网站下载
首先,访问MySQL官方站点 MySQL Downloads,选择相应的操作系统版本进行下载。MySQL 8.0.19支持多种操作系统,如Windows、Linux、MacOS等。在网站上,你可以选择安装包的类型,例如ZIP、TAR等,推荐选择适合自己系统的安装包。
2. 下载前的准备工作
在下载之前,确保你的系统满足安装MySQL 8.0.19的最低要求。例如,在Windows系统上,需要确保系统版本是Windows 7或更高版本,同时需要安装Visual C++ Redistributable for Visual Studio 2015。Linux系统上需要确保有足够的存储空间和依赖库。
二、安装MySQL 8.0.19
1. Windows系统安装
1.1 解压安装包
下载完成后,将ZIP安装包解压到指定的文件夹。建议将其解压到一个较为简单的路径,例如C:mysql。
1.2 配置环境变量
为了方便在命令行中运行MySQL命令,需要将MySQL的bin目录添加到系统环境变量中。右键点击“计算机”图标,选择“属性” -> “高级系统设置” -> “环境变量”,在“系统变量”中找到Path变量,添加MySQL bin目录的路径。
1.3 初始化数据库
打开命令行窗口,进入MySQL的bin目录,执行以下命令初始化数据库:
mysqld --initialize --console
这条命令会生成一个临时的root用户密码,记住这个密码,因为后面需要用到。
1.4 安装和启动MySQL服务
执行以下命令安装MySQL服务:
mysqld --install
然后启动MySQL服务:
net start mysql
2. Linux系统安装
2.1 添加MySQL APT源
首先,下载MySQL APT源:
wget https://dev.mysql.com/get/mysql-apt-config_0.8.15-1_all.deb
安装MySQL APT源:
sudo dpkg -i mysql-apt-config_0.8.15-1_all.deb
根据提示选择MySQL版本,然后更新APT包列表:
sudo apt-get update
2.2 安装MySQL
执行以下命令安装MySQL:
sudo apt-get install mysql-server
2.3 启动MySQL服务
安装完成后,启动MySQL服务:
sudo systemctl start mysql
三、配置MySQL 8.0.19
1. 安全配置
为了确保MySQL的安全性,执行以下命令进行安全配置:
mysql_secure_installation
根据提示设置root用户密码、删除匿名用户、禁用远程root登录以及删除测试数据库。
2. 编辑MySQL配置文件
在Windows系统上,MySQL的配置文件是my.ini,通常位于MySQL安装目录的根目录。在Linux系统上,配置文件是my.cnf,通常位于/etc/mysql/目录下。根据需要修改配置文件,例如设置字符集、调整缓冲区大小等。
四、启动MySQL服务
在完成配置后,确保MySQL服务正常启动。可以使用以下命令检查MySQL服务状态:
Windows系统
net start mysql
Linux系统
sudo systemctl start mysql
五、设置root用户密码
如果在初始化数据库时没有设置root用户密码,可以通过以下步骤设置:
1. 登录MySQL
使用临时密码登录MySQL:
mysql -u root -p
2. 修改root用户密码
在MySQL命令行中执行以下命令修改root用户密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
将new_password替换为你要设置的新密码。
六、测试连接
为了确保MySQL安装和配置成功,可以通过以下步骤测试连接:
1. 使用命令行测试
在命令行中执行以下命令测试连接:
mysql -u root -p
输入密码后,如果成功进入MySQL命令行界面,说明连接正常。
2. 使用图形化工具测试
可以使用图形化工具如MySQL Workbench、Navicat等连接数据库,输入相应的主机地址、用户名和密码,测试连接是否成功。
通过上述步骤,你应该能够成功安装并配置MySQL 8.0.19。需要注意的是,MySQL的安装和配置可能会因操作系统和具体环境的不同而有所差异,因此在实际操作中应根据具体情况进行调整。如果在项目团队管理中需要使用MySQL数据库,可以结合使用研发项目管理系统PingCode和通用项目协作软件Worktile,以提高团队协作效率和项目管理水平。
相关问答FAQs:
Q: 什么是MySQL数据库8.0.19?
A: MySQL数据库8.0.19是一种常用的关系型数据库管理系统,它提供了存储和管理数据的功能,适用于各种规模的应用程序和网站。
Q: 我需要安装MySQL数据库8.0.19吗?
A: 如果你需要在你的计算机上运行MySQL数据库或者开发使用MySQL的应用程序,那么你需要安装MySQL数据库8.0.19。
Q: 如何安装MySQL数据库8.0.19?
A: 下面是安装MySQL数据库8.0.19的简单步骤:
- 访问MySQL官方网站并下载MySQL 8.0.19的安装程序。
- 运行安装程序,按照提示进行安装。
- 在安装过程中,你可以选择默认安装或自定义安装选项。如果你不熟悉MySQL的配置,建议选择默认安装选项。
- 在安装过程中,你需要设置root用户的密码,这是数据库的管理员账号。请记住这个密码,以便后续使用。
- 安装完成后,你可以通过命令行或者图形化工具来管理和使用MySQL数据库。
希望以上FAQ对你有所帮助!如果你还有其他问题,请随时提问。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1804353